Azucely is a modern Spanish name, likely derived from 'azucena,' meaning 'lily,' symbolizing purity and beauty. The suffix '-ely' adds a lyrical, feminine touch. It embodies a floral elegance, blending traditional Spanish roots with contemporary naming trends, evoking imagery of bright, fragrant blossoms and radiant femininity.

Cultural Significance of Azucely

In Spanish-speaking cultures, names derived from flowers like 'Azucena' carry deep symbolism of purity, beauty, and grace. 'Azucely' builds on this tradition, blending the classic floral motif with a modern twist. It reflects cultural appreciation for nature and femininity, often chosen to celebrate heritage and a connection to natural beauty.
